On average across the year,
yes, Greece is hotter than
Bowie, Maryland
.
Greece has an average temperature of 18°C/64°F and Bowie, Maryland has an average temperature of 14°C/57°F.
Greece's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 33°C/91°F, which is hotter than Bowie, Maryland's hottest month (also July, with an average maximum temperature of 31°C/88°F).
On average across the year, no, Greece is not colder than Bowie, Maryland . Greece has an average minimum temperature of 13°C/55°F and Bowie, Maryland has an average minimum temperature of 8°C/46°F.
On average across the year,
no, Greece has less rain than
Bowie, Maryland. Greece has an average annual rainfall of 289mm and Bowie, Maryland has an average annual rainfall of 1269mm.
Greece's wettest month is January, with an average monthly rainfall of 48mm, which is drier than Bowie, Maryland's wettest month (August, with an average monthly rainfall of 147mm).
